Verdict: which is better?

Astroproxy is very cheap (from $0.10) with three proxy types on a 50M pool but no review record. Proxiware adds ISP, has a larger 100M+ pool and a stellar 4.9 rating on 235 reviews. Choose Astroproxy for rock-bottom pricing; choose Proxiware for proven, top-rated four-type proxies at scale.

Astroproxy vs Proxiware FAQ

Is Astroproxy cheaper than Proxiware?

Astroproxy has the lower entry price at $0.10 per payg, compared with $0.15 per GB for Proxiware. Always size the cost to your real monthly usage, since per-GB and per-IP plans scale differently.

Which has more locations, Astroproxy or Proxiware?

Proxiware advertises the wider footprint with 165 countries versus 100 for Astroproxy.

Which has a bigger proxy network, Astroproxy or Proxiware?

Proxiware lists the larger IP pool at 100M+, while Astroproxy lists 50M+. A larger pool usually means more unique IPs and lower block rates at scale.
